NEW YORK (AP) — Image after image splashes on the wall of the art exhibit — a snapshot of young …read more
Source: Yahoo Technology Feed
NEW YORK (AP) — Image after image splashes on the wall of the art exhibit — a snapshot of young …read more
Source: Yahoo Technology Feed